To reconstruct the piece of classical music, Giazotto needed to work as both composer and historian. He wrote new material where the fragment broke off while remaining faithful to the Baroque styles of Albinoni’s time, which favored high contrasts, prominent string sections, and a unified mood throughout each piece. The mood Giazotto set for Alhinnni’s fragment is somber and pierced with yearning. The Adagio begins with double bass (the Lowest of the stringed instruments) marking a brooding, dirge-like rhythm, while the pipe organ __________a gentle introductory tune above it. When the rest of the ensemble – violins, violas, and cellos – joins in, the melody cascades in an emotionally evocative torrent of sound.

A. play

B. are playing

C. plays

D. have played

2. Despite the attractiveness of camera trapping for gathering information, the researchers cautioned that the benefits of using box traps, therefore, should not be disregarded. Among other advantages, box traps allow scientists to inspect animals more closely, perform health screenings, and collect genetic data. Depending on how often box traps are checked, camera trapping may also be more expensive because of the high initial start-up costs of camera traps, and this is especially true for short-term studies. However, the experiment with the two types of traps___________that camera trapping can be an efficient tool for researchers to learn about an area’s animal populations.

A. show

B. have shown

C. shows

D. were showing

3. According to a 2012 report by the US Forest Service, the number of trees in American cities __________in sharp decline, with an estimated loss of about 4 million trees each year. This loss is due to many urban development and lack of replanting when trees die of natural causes. While their value is often overlooked, trees are an environmental and economic asset: trees, like the buildings around them, form a vital part of a city’s infrastructure, making their preservation well worth the investment

A. have been

B. are

C. is

D. were

While exploring Nevada’s Gypsum Cave in 1930, Seneca and Abenaki archaeologist Bertha Parker made her most famous discovery: the skull of a now-extinct ground sloth (Nothrotheriops shastensis) alongside human-made tools. Parker’s crucial finding was the first ______ humans in North America as far back as 10,000 years ago.

Which choice completes the text so that it conforms to the conventions of Standard English?

A. place

B. to place

C. places

D. placed

6. The curves of a river ______ its sinuosity index, a ratio that compares the winding length the river travels to the straight-line distance between the river’s beginning and end.

Which choice completes the text so that it conforms to the conventions of Standard English?

A. determine

B. determined

C. has determined

D. determines

7. Classical composer Florence Price’s 1927 move to Chicago marked a turning point in her career. It was there that Price premiered her First Symphony—a piece that was praised for blending traditional Romantic motifs with aspects of Black folk music—and ______ supportive relationships with other Black artists.

Which choice completes the text so that it conforms to the conventions of Standard English?

A. developing

B. Developed

C. to develop

D. have developing
